From another perspective, no matter who gets dragged into the police station, not knowing what crime they’ve committed, and with no one paying attention to them, who would have an appetite to eat anything?
Moreover, from a young age, she’s always been afraid of entering a police station, and she has a certain psychological shadow regarding this place, which made her feel uneasy from the moment she entered here.
Most importantly, after bringing her back here, those people confiscated her phone and luggage, leaving her unable to contact anyone. After giving her some food, they ignored her, further turning her initial unease into growing agitation.
At this moment, the originally closed office door was suddenly opened from the outside. Song Qiao instinctively jerked her head up to look towards the door but immediately froze, motionless.
At the doorway stood a man in a suit, his tall and upright figure almost blocking the scene and light from outside.
How did Song Qiao feel upon seeing this man again?
You could say she could hardly believe they were meeting like this again; or perhaps, she felt a bit dumbfounded.
Was she ready to meet this man? Definitely not.
As soon as Lu Jingchen opened the door, he saw Song Qiao seated on the only single sofa in the office. Although there was no obvious change in his expression, his eyes suddenly tightened, and the hand holding the phone at his side clenched so hard it almost deformed the device.
Looking at the woman seated there, if not for the familiarity of her face, he almost couldn’t connect her with the woman from his memory.
Compared to five years ago, Song Qiao seemed more mature and more charismatic. The previously smooth and straight long hair had now been changed to large wavy curls.
The two remained silent for a moment, one standing at the door and the other sitting there, quietly meeting each other’s gaze.
Song Qiao felt extremely uncomfortable under the man’s gaze, furrowing her brows slightly as she seemed to recall something. Her expression changed, and she stood up.
Wearing high heels, she walked straight to the door and spoke faintly, "Excuse me, please step aside."
However, the man didn’t move, still quietly gazing at her. After seemingly taking enough of a look, he curled his lips into a slight smile and began to speak, "Mrs. Lu, after traveling for five years, have you missed me and our son?"
Upon hearing his words, Song Qiao was momentarily stunned, but quickly regained her composure, unfazed, and responded coolly with slightly parted red lips, "Sorry, Mr. Lu, we’ve already divorced. I haven’t been Mrs. Lu since five years ago. Please call me your ex-wife or Miss Song!"
The man, now more mature than five years ago, took a step forward, his deep eyes fixed on her, seemingly unconcerned with her words. He raised his hand to grab her arm unexpectedly, pulling her into his embrace. His voice was soft yet slightly seductive as he spoke, "I haven’t signed the divorce papers, nor have I completed the procedures. Where’s the ex-wife? Come on, let’s go back and discuss raising our children and having a second one..."
Song Qiao looked at the man before her and finally understood why she had suddenly been brought into the police station, feeling angry and tempted to take off her high heels to throw them at his head.
Her expression turned colder as she spoke through gritted teeth, "Lu Jingchen, have some decency! Even if you haven’t signed the divorce agreement, I can still go to court and file for divorce after five years of separation. This marriage has been dead in the water for five years. Get out of my way..."
After saying this, she reached out to push the man in front of her.
Lu Jingchen grabbed her reaching hand, holding her even tighter in his arms. With a quick step, he turned with Song Qiao, moving directly into the office. His other hand, previously holding a phone, had at some point already placed it in his pocket, and he swiftly closed the door.
When Song Qiao realized what was happening, she found herself pinned against the door, unable to move. This made her face turn green and pale due to their overly intimate and inappropriate position...
Suppressing the anger within her, Song Qiao resisted the urge to curse, reaching out with force to push the man in front of her, only to realize her long period of hunger left her too weak to exert much strength, making her more frustrated, "Lu Jingchen, let me go. If you keep this up, I’ll take you to court."
Damn it, does he really think I’m that easy to bully, getting handsy at the slightest disagreement?
Lu Jingchen gazed at the woman close to him, the sensation of warmth and softness in his arms. The familiar scent from Song Qiao made him feel like lush grass was beginning to sprout in a previously barren place in his heart, calming the earlier restlessness.
This feeling hadn’t been there for the past five years.
Even though he had tried to forget Song Qiao and be with other women, he still couldn’t.
Lowering his head near her, his thin lips softly parted as he spoke, "Song Qiao, you left five years ago. Why return now? Since you’ve returned, you must know that I won’t let you go easily, especially when... we have a son..."
Upon hearing the words ’son,’ Song Qiao’s expression changed. One purpose of her return was to see if her son was well, if Lu Jingchen had been good to him, and whether he knew that she was his mother.
After all, he was a piece of flesh birthed from her body. Even though she had a daughter by her side, Song Qiao had missed her son dearly over these past five years.
There were even moments when she regretted giving her son to Lu Jingchen, to the Lu Family...
Her lips moved, wanting to say something, but dizziness overcame her, forcing her to close her eyes momentarily. She found herself unable to resist, with her body turning weak, before everything went black.
Lu Jingchen intended to say more, but before he could, he saw the woman before him suddenly close her eyes, her body going limp. Had he not been holding her waist, she might have collapsed to the ground.
Seeing Song Qiao faint, Lu Jingchen’s heart turned chaotic, kneeling on one knee to cradle her in his arms, urgently speaking, "Song Qiao, Song Qiao, what’s wrong? Wake up..."
